A programme has been announced for the International Conference on Carbon Storage in Wood Products.

The September 1 event in Brussels will cover the science on how much carbon is stored in wood products, as well as how a carbon credit system could be set up (based on the scientific evidence) in a way that can benefit the woodworking industries.

Speakers include Ludovic Guinard, of French wood industry technology centre FCBA, who will over the effectiveness and feasibility of attributing an economic value to the carbon stored in wood products.

Dra Ana Claudia Dias of Aveiro University will discuss methods and approaches for estimating carbon storage.

CEI-BOIS chairman Mikael Eliasson will draw together the conclusions from the event.

The conference is part of the “wood in sustainable development” process of CEI-Bois’ Roadmap 2010, run by the European Panel Federation and the European Organisation of the Sawmill Industry.
